Jeffro has a good suggestion with a BIN and best offer feature. That way you can set the BIN at what you want and consider lower offers if you need the cash. Drawback with this would be that you would still have to pay the listing fees if no one offered you a good price and the FVF are higher with BIN sales.

 

do an advance search on Ebay and see what previous books sold, then do a bin for

something close to that range.

Next to selling them yourself on E-Bay or the boards, my opinion would be to consign the books to Storms. Among consignment options, Bob is simply the best. He's got a large clientele of SA and BA buyers, impeccable integrity and honesty, a long track record of selling comics without first squishing them into pancakes, and he sends payment as soon as the buyer's payment clears.

seriously, clink if you have good books to sell (will only cost you 10%) but you have to wait a month for your mula

 

ebay has those 5 free listings with minimal FVFees and you can probably get paid in a day after auctions over

 

heritage will cash advance you, but on $200 books, likely going to cost you 30% of the sale price, so unlikely that is worth it

 

run a 10% off sale on the boards (same commission you would pay) and see if that works (thumbs u
